Volleyball Falls to Malone in Five Sets on Friday

The Ursuline College volleyball team opened up the Wayne State Invitational with a tough five-set loss to fellow Great Midwest school Malone on Friday afternoon.
 
The Pioneers jumped out quickly in each of the first two sets and won 25-16 and 25-15 to take a 2-0 lead in the match.
 
Ursuline trailed 11-5 in the third set but were able to come back and pull within a point at 16-15 before eventually tying the game up at 18-18 after a kill by junior Hannah Hottinger. The Arrows took the lead for the first time at 19-18.
 
The Arrows went onto win the third set 28-26 and forced a fifth and deciding set by winning the fourth set 26-24.
 
Malone won a back-and-forth fifth set 15-10 to take the match in five.
 
The Arrows were paced by senior Vikki Henderson who finished with 14 kills and freshman Devin Gerth who had 10. Senior Jill Morrow added eight kills. Sophomore Regan Nickol notched 40 assists while junior Zoe Skinner had a match-high 22 digs.
 
Ursuline will take on host Wayne State at 2:30 PM in their second and final match of the day before playing two matches on Saturday.
